"Radiography/emergency care"

About: Leongatha Memorial Hospital / Urgent Care Centre

(as the patient),

I  attended to undergo a CAT scan, the first attempt at which was extremely painful due to the injury incurred. Radiography staff were very understanding and they involved nursing and emergency staff to treat me for pain and distress so that the procedure could eventually go ahead.

Emergency staff were totally engaged in following up results and did not want me to leave until they were ok with the results. Against advice I did leave but received a phone call from the attending doctor to convey the results.

I felt surrounded by care and professional expertise and it has given me confidence in being able to age (I am late 70s) well supported in my community
